Hydrocortisone Cream (1%) temporarily relieves itching associated with minor skin irritations, inflammation or rashes due to eczema, insect bites, poison oak, poison sumac, soaps, detergents, cosmetics, jewelry, seborrheic dermatitis, psoriasis, scrapes and more.

Got an itch? Here are 5 suggested ways to use 1% Hydrocortisone Cream.
Treating Sunburn – Along with using Aloe Vera, you can use Hydrocortisone Cream to treat your sunburn.
Itchy Facial Hair – If you decide to grow a beard or mustache and you are relatively new to the facial hair game because you barely let your 5 o’clock shadow show – you may notice that your beard is quite itchy. Hydrocortisone Cream can totally help with this.
Treating Eczema – Hydrocortisone cream can help relive redness and itching for some people with a mild case of eczema.
Relieving Itchy Ears – If you have itchy ears, typically the cause is dandruff or dry skin. To help relieve this itchiness you can use a drop or two of hydrocortisone cream to help with the itching feeling.
Insect Bites – After spending the night around the campfire chances are you may have been bitten by a creepy crawler and you have the bug bites to prove it. Rather than spending all day itching to no relief, use some hydrocortisone cream to soothe the affected area.
In many cases this cream does not need to be used for extended periods of time. If you begin to notice an allergic reaction, you should discontinue use and consult your physician.
